This work proposes the use of bandstop filtering (BSF) as a pretreatment method in the quantitative analysis of glucose from both near‐infrared (NIR) and midinfrared (MIR) spectra. The proposed method is investigated and evaluated against the traditional bandpass filtering (BPF) and implemented with the linear calibration models principal component regression (PCR) and partial least squares regression...
This paper proposes a novel pre-processing method based on combining bandpass with Savitzky-Golay filtering to further improve the prediction performance of the linear calibration models Principal Component Regression (PCR) and Partial Least Squares Regression (PLSR) in near infrared spectroscopy. The proposed method is compared to the highly efficient RReliefF pre-processing technique for further...
